E3
Vax
Solution Pump Circuit Fault
Display shows E3 and solution pump does not spray water onto carpet

Possible Causes
Airlock in solution pump, Blocked solution line or spray jets, Failed solution pump motor, Loose or corroded pump wiring connector
How to Fix / Troubleshooting
Safety first: Unplug the carpet cleaner and remove the clean water/solution tank before inspection.
- Check solution tank seating: Ensure the clean water/solution tank is filled and correctly seated. On many Vax models, a valve at the bottom of the tank must press onto a seal on the base. Reseat firmly until you hear/feel a click.
- Prime the pump: Refit the tank, plug in the machine, and (if safe to do so) hold the trigger for 30–60 seconds to allow the pump to draw solution. If no spray, stop and unplug.
- Clean spray nozzles: Remove the front nozzle/spray bar. Soak it in warm water with a little washing-up liquid. Use a soft brush or toothpick to clear each jet. Rinse thoroughly and refit.
- Inspect solution hose: Check the clear solution hose from the tank to the pump and from the pump to the spray bar for kinks or pinches. Straighten or reroute as needed.
- Check pump wiring: Access the solution pump (usually near the base). Inspect the 2-wire connector for corrosion or looseness. Reseat the connector. If you have a multimeter, check for voltage at the pump when the trigger is pressed (machine plugged in and running – only for trained persons).
- Replace pump if failed: If the pump receives power but does not run or is noisy with no output, replace the solution pump assembly.
